3. Fashion Institute of Technology (FIT) for Fashion Design program

fashion 3

FIT’s Fashion Design program has produced creative and innovative leaders for the global fashion industry for nearly eight decades.

Students at one of the world’s most prestigious programs have the opportunity to network with industry leaders and develop cutting-edge ideas that are guided by market research and infused with inspiration from many historical and cultural periods. With the help of our well-connected teachers, you’ll develop your creative vision while also becoming a professional equipped to take on the challenges of this demanding sector.

The AAS curriculum uses computer-aided design, sketching, draping, patternmaking, construction methods, and sewing techniques and textiles. After completing your AAS, you can apply for a BFA in Fashion Design at the university level. Fabric Styling and Textile/Surface Design BFA degrees, as well as the BS in Production Management: Fashion and Related Industries, Technical Design, and Textile Development and Marketing, are all available to you.

Children’s clothing, intimate apparel, knitwear, special occasion, and sportswear are among the concentrations available in the BFA program. You’ll use market research and inspiration from art, history, and culture to create designs that are unique and appealing to your customers. Throughout the program, you’ll learn about cutting-edge technology, improve your public speaking abilities, and select from various design electives to tailor your education to your interests. Finally, the curriculum concludes with a mandatory internship and a senior collection designed under the guidance of well-known designers who act as mentors. There is a chance that your work might be featured in the Future of Fashion, a professionally staged catwalk event at FIT.

10. Rhode Island School of Design (RISD) for Fashion Design Classes

fashion 10

Through examining period clothing influences and how couture designers have interpreted them, this course examines historic costume’s relationship to modern fashion. Students will learn to recognize historical periods, clothing, textiles, construction, and proper methods of the era through the semester. To illustrate their designs for modern clothes, students will draw and develop concept boards based on historical precedents from each period.

Students in this class are challenged to go outside the box to define femininity in fashion. Work generated challenges in a male-dominated field and modified ideas about how clothing integrates with the environment and culture. Students create concept boards, a small dress form design, and a final garment for female, masculine, or gender-neutral wear. Students are expected to conduct their research and produce relevant and well-executed work demonstrating their engagement with new ideas regarding the female body. You don’t even need to know how to sew.

11. School of the Art Institute of Chicago (SAIC) for Online Fashion Courses

fashion 11

Cloth-making has been a highly sought-after skill throughout the history of civilization. Continuing this history, students will gain a solid foundation in current garment production by becoming familiar with the basic seams and finishes employed. There is a strong emphasis on industry standards in sewing, and all techniques are taught and practiced in the classroom. Students will use their newly-acquired sewing skills in two distinct projects.

In addition, students will learn about fabric properties and how to copy and cut designs during the lesson properly. These techniques can be used to stitch together garments from patterns, develop creative strategies, or explore fabric as a medium for soft sculpture once they’ve been mastered. Sewing experience is not required. Online students must have a sewing machine to take this course.

Assembling clothing that covers the upper part of a woman’s body is the focus of this elective. For constructing a button-down shirt with long sleeves and a lined, zippered shell, the author offers you industry-standard sewing techniques and advice. If you’ve learned anything from this course, you’ll be able to apply what you’ve learned in the workplace.
